Abstract Submission Guidelines:

All submissions should be of original research and should preferably not have been previously accepted for publication in a journal, presented in another conference or be under review at another conference. The abstract should contain the following sections:
  • Introduction
  • Methodology
  • Results and Discussion
  • Conclusions
Abstracts should not exceed 350 words excluding the abstract title.

The introduction should give a brief background of the research topic, stating the problem and leading to the aim of the specific research.

A brief description of the methodology and techniques used in the research should be given.

The results and discussion section should give a concise presentation of experimental results obtained and highlight any trends or points of interest. Statements such as "results will be presented" or "will be discussed" are not acceptable and such abstracts will be rejected.

A brief explanation of the significance and implications of the work reported should conclude the abstract.
